As part of your security review, please note that responsibility for GraphLoom, our dependency graph visualizer, transferred teams on the first of the month. GraphLoom ingests build manifests from the internal artifact registry and renders transitive dependency maps; it holds read-only tokens scoped to manifest metadata. The previous team's access has been revoked, and token rotation completed last week. Findings, access questions, and remediation timelines for GraphLoom should be directed to the current owner, identified below.

named custodian: Gorwyn Kasath Sorael

- [ ] **Step 7: Breaker override escrow.** After sealing the signing keys for the Tallgrove upstream API circuit breaker, confirm the support team can force the breaker open during a full outage. The override bundle lives in the sealed escrow drawer and is useless without its unlock phrase. Two ceremony witnesses must initial this step before proceeding. The escrow bundle is decrypted with the recovery passphrase that follows.

vault phrase of kahip-kahop = holath-quenmir

# Artifact Signing

All builds of the Moonshoal tide-table widget must be signed before submission to the plugin registry. Unsigned artifacts are rejected automatically, and resubmission requires a new version number. Plugin authors should sign the packaged widget archive, not individual source files, and confirm the signature locally before upload. Signatures are checked against the registry's trusted keyring at publish time. The current public verification key for the Moonshoal widget pipeline is listed below.

rollout seal: bky9_PeXH1fTLY

Meeting notes — Fleet & Assets sync, Tuesday. Marla confirmed the twelve leased laptops from the Delverton office are boxed and inventoried against the Quillhart Leasing return sheet. Devices were wiped Friday; chargers are bagged separately per lot. Pickup is scheduled Thursday morning from the Delverton loading bay, and Quillhart's courier will sign the manifest on site. The courier must quote the following phrase before the boxes are released:

dispatch memo: the sorox briiel courier leaves the druius kelion fenir gorvan ralael rusius julwyn belwyn ledger at gate 4220 under passcode 637242